Man injured following motorway smash

A man suffered a fractured right leg following an accident on the northbound carriageway of the M6 near the Charnock Richard service station in Chorley this morning.

The man, from Standish, had been driving a grey Nissan Primera vehicle at the time of the crash.

Police believe the vehicle spun round following a tyre blow out and hit a lamp post on the northbound carriageway of the motorway between J27 A5209 (Standish) and J28 B5256 Leyland).

Firecrews from Leyland and the air ambulance have been on the scene since just after 8am.

The vehicle is now facing the wrong way on the carriageway and traffic is delayed and travelling on the hard shoulder between J27 A5209 (Standish) and J28 B5256 (Leyland).
